Hey Priya — handing over the Quillbase static-analysis setup. Heads up: the baseline file (`sa-baseline.yml`) suppresses about 140 legacy findings so new PRs stay clean. Don't let anyone add fresh suppressions without a ticket — that's the whole game. I've been burning down roughly ten entries a sprint. The suppression policy and the burn-down tracker are on the page below.

runbook for fajep-yahop: https://rundeck.braskdata.example/repo/run/pages/job/dfe5b8c563356906

**Ticket: Signature check failure — Gabwell sampling config**

The log-sampling config for the Gabwell service (chatty by design, sampled at 1:500) failed signature verification during last night's deploy. Root cause: config was re-serialized by a formatting hook after signing, invalidating the digest. Fix: sign after formatting, never before. Added a CI guard that re-verifies the final artifact. Future maintainers — do not reorder these pipeline stages. Verification uses the key below.

signing key of bagap-yawep = bky13_TbfT6ZMUoGJo2

### RestockPilot: Release Prerequisites

Before cutting a release, confirm that the RestockPilot planner can reach the SnackGrid inventory service, since the build pipeline runs an integration smoke test against staging during packaging. A failed handshake here blocks the release tag, so verify credentials first. The pipeline reads its staging credential from the deploy config; for reference and manual verification, the current key appears below.

service key, tajof-fawip: vxb4-JNOz